Output d95fa5494e00249a888a38ddf8fa397ed5430151f46c1612b7128a038c5eda07:16

value
4451912
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21c1b5de6efd4b95bfdaa5bf797b4c8f8ea5ea54 OP_EQUALVERIFY OP_CHECKSIG
address
145VMZsR92odJDCVjJC9pnSPoEXjJ1j3Cp
transaction
d95fa5494e00249a888a38ddf8fa397ed5430151f46c1612b7128a038c5eda07
confirmations
527965
spent
true